The Profound Influence of Mindset on Occupational Satisfaction and Fulfillment



This article explores the intricate relationship between mindset and work satisfaction, drawing upon established psychological frameworks to illuminate how cognitive patterns significantly shape professional experiences and overall career fulfillment. We will define key concepts such as mindset (a cognitive framework influencing perceptions and responses), growth mindset (a belief in one's capacity for development), fixed mindset (a belief that abilities are innate and unchangeable), job satisfaction (an affective response to work experiences), and career fulfillment (a sense of meaning and purpose derived from one's vocation). We will analyze how various mindset approaches – growth, fixed, positive, resilient, and success-oriented – impact different facets of work life, providing practical implications and suggesting avenues for future research.



1. The Growth Mindset and Continuous Professional Development: A growth mindset, as posited by Carol Dweck's theory, is characterized by a belief in the malleability of abilities. This perspective transforms challenges into opportunities for learning and skill enhancement, leading to increased job satisfaction and career fulfillment. Individuals with a growth mindset are more likely to actively seek professional development opportunities, embrace feedback constructively, and demonstrate greater adaptability in dynamic work environments. This contrasts sharply with a fixed mindset, where individuals view abilities as static, leading to avoidance of challenges and diminished job satisfaction.



2. Positive Mindset and Enhanced Work Relationships: A positive mindset, aligning with the principles of Positive Psychology, significantly impacts interpersonal dynamics in the workplace. Individuals with a positive outlook tend to exhibit higher levels of emotional intelligence, fostering more collaborative and supportive relationships with colleagues. This positive social environment contributes to increased job satisfaction and a more enjoyable work experience. Conversely, negativity can create a toxic environment, affecting morale and productivity. This is supported by social cognitive theory, which emphasizes the role of social interactions in shaping behavior and attitudes.



3. Success Mindset and Goal Achievement: Goal-Setting Theory underscores the importance of setting spec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ART) goals. A success mindset, characterized by a proactive approach to goal-setting and achievement, empowers individuals to create a sense of progress and accomplishment, thereby enhancing job satisfaction. This sense of accomplishment contributes directly to intrinsic motivation and a heightened sense of self-efficacy. Individuals with a strong success mindset are more likely to persevere in the face of obstacles, fueled by their belief in their ability to overcome challenges.



4. Resilience and Adaptability in the Face of Setbacks: The concept of resilience, crucial in navigating the unpredictable nature of work, allows individuals to bounce back from setbacks and adversity. Drawing upon the stress-coping model, we can understand how a resilient mindset equips individuals with the cognitive and emotional resources to cope effectively with work-related stress and challenges. Individuals demonstrating resilience are better able to maintain their productivity and job satisfaction even in the face of unexpected difficulties.




5. Mindset and the Pursuit of Meaning and Purpose: Self-Determination Theory emphasizes the importance of autonomy, competence, and relatedness in achieving intrinsic motivation and fulfillment. A positive mindset, combined with a clear understanding of one's values and aspirations, can foster a sense of meaning and purpose in one's work. When individuals perceive their work as aligned with their personal values, they experience greater job satisfaction and a deeper sense of career fulfillment. This intrinsic motivation is a significant driver of productivity and long-term career success.




Conclusions and Recommendations: This exploration reveals a strong correlation between mindset and occupational satisfaction. Cultivating a growth mindset, a positive outlook, a focus on success, and resilience significantly enhances job satisfaction and overall career fulfillment. Organizations can foster these mindsets through training programs focused on emotional intelligence, resilience-building techniques, and goal-setting strategies. Further research could investigate the specific mechanisms by which different mindset types interact with various organizational factors to influence work outcomes. Longitudinal studies are particularly needed to track the long-term impact of mindset interventions on career trajectory and overall well-being. The findings of this analysis have broad applicability across various industries and professional roles, offering valuable insights for individual career development and organizational human resource management practices.
